Athena Bitcoin Registers 473 Million Shares for Resale

BY Solomon M.·2 MIN READ·JULY 8, 2025

Athena Bitcoin Global has fil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ission to register 473 million shares for resale, aiming to provide liquidity for early investors, insiders, and former employees.

Athena Bitcoin Registers 473 Million Shares for Resale

The filing is significant for early investors, allowing them to sell shares publicly. It highlights Athena’s strategic focus on enhancing liquidity without raising new capital, potentially affecting stock volatility in its OTC market.

Athena Bitcoin Global, a major player in the crypto ATM industry, filed an S-1 statement with the SEC. The registration allows early investors and insiders to resell shares per prior investments. The stock, traded on OTC markets, might experience volatility.

The registration is not a capital-raising move but intended to enable equity liquidation. Athena’s filing marks a critical moment for shareholders. The firm’s approach benefits insiders without injecting new funds into corporate coffers.

Potential stock volatility in OTC markets is anticipated, given the influx of registered shares. The event might pressure prices but does not affect major cryptocurrencies. Athena’s focus remains on fiat-to-crypto services and ATM operations.

While the filing affects Athena’s stock dynamics, implications for the crypto market remain minimal. The focus is on equity liquidity rather than direct crypto market interaction. History shows similar moves often lead to short-term price fluctuations.

Insights suggest some pressure on Athena’s stock price, though broader market effects are limited. Historical precedents indicate that such equity strategies typically result in temporary volatility without long-lasting market upheaval.
